1.14 release notes: "Python is Optional" Fix inaccuracy, reorder text

* docs/release-notes/1.14.html:

("Python is Optional" note box):

Fix inaccurate statement regarding hook scripts coded in Python

being (necessarily) affected by the change to Python 3. This is

only true of scripts that use the SWIG Python bindings. Also,

reorder the text for readability: immediately after mentioning the

SWIG bindings, list what they're used for.

Suggested by: danielsh

1.14 release notes: Remove leading space in link to Python PEP-0373

* docs/release-notes/1.14.html:

("Support for Python 2.7 is being phased out"):

Remove unwanted leading space in hyperlink to Python PEP-0373 that

is apparent in the rendered HTML (and also maintain consistency

with our HTML syntax elsewhere) by moving the closing angle

bracket of the 'a' tag to the following line.

Found by: danielsh

Merge 'staging' to 'publish'.
  1. … 4 more files in changeset.
* publish/docs/release-notes/1.14.html: Stop claiming the book will be updated.
Add 1.14 release notes skeleton.

Generated by: write-release-notes --edit-html-file=docs/release-notes/1.14.html 1.14.0

* publish/docs/release-notes/index.html

(#release-notes-list): Add this id to the existing list, so that write-release-notes will be able to insert a new entry here.

* publish/docs/release-notes/index.html: Correct the 1.13.0 release date.
* docs/release-notes/release-history.html: Fix typo.
* publish/docs/release-notes/1.13.html

(#non-lts-release): Trim unnecessary old notes.

* publish/docs/release-notes/1.13.html

(#new-feature-compatibility-table): Add 'svnadmin rev-size'.

Found by: brane

* publish/docs/release-notes/1.13.html

(#new-features): Move 'svnadmin rev-size' here from '#enhancements'.

Found by: brane

Subversion 1.13.0 released.
  1. … 6 more files in changeset.
* publish/docs/release-notes/1.13.html: Add 'work in progress' warning.
* publish/docs/release-notes/1.13.html: Add the significant changes.
* publish/docs/release-notes/1.13.html: Replace with a template.

Generated by: ' write-release-notes'

* publish/docs/release-notes/1.13.html: New: (temporary) release notes.
Supported releases: Remove 'support period' column.

The info in it was simply wrong. Rather than correcting it, remove it as

correct and clearer details are already stated on the linked 'release planning' page.

site: Auto-update the link the the current release's STATUS file to always

point to the current stable branch.

* publish/docs/release-notes/index.html

(#upcoming-patch-release): Move a sentence from here..

* publish/upcoming.part.html: .. to here, which is automatically generated ..

* tools/ .. here.

* tools/

(Version.__str__): New.

(get_reference_version): Add comment.

  1. … 3 more files in changeset.
Make the 'upcoming changes' script tell which branch it's reporting, and remove that info from the prose.
  1. … 1 more file in changeset.
Announce Subversion 1.12.2, 1.10.6, 1.9.12.

A merge from 'staging' plus updating the date of the news item.

  1. … 6 more files in changeset.
* publish/docs/release-notes/index.html: Update release numbers.
* publish/docs/release-notes/1.12.html: Remove WIP notice, now 1.12 is released.

Thanks to Paul Cameron for pointing it out.

Announce Subversion 1.12.0
  1. … 4 more files in changeset.
publish: merge from staging
  1. … 1 more file in changeset.
publish: merge from staging
  1. … 1 more file in changeset.
publish: merge from staging

  1. … 1 more file in changeset.
* publish: merge from staging

  1. … 1 more file in changeset.
* docs/release-notes/1.12.html

(github-issue): Remove. Issue was resolved by Github end of December 2018.

* publish/docs/release-notes/index.html

(upcoming-patch-release): Tiny wording tweaks.

* publish/docs/release-notes/index.html

(upcoming-patch-release): Improve the description. Link to the generator script.